Osvaldo Cruz weather in December

In December, Osvaldo Cruz sees average daytime highs of 31°C and overnight lows near 22°C, with 172 mm of rain across 18.8 wet days and about 13.3 hours of daylight. It is the 3rd-warmest and 3rd-wettest month of the year here.

Day-to-day highs hold fairly steady near 31°C through the month. The sky is clear or mostly clear about 20% of the time in December, and the air most often feels oppressive.

Daylight stretches from about 13 h 12 min at the start of December to 13 h 18 min by month's end. Set against the rest of the year, December is Osvaldo Cruz's 11th-clearest and 8th-windiest month. For the whole year in context, see Osvaldo Cruz's year-round climate.

Temperature in December

Average highAverage lowShaded bands: 10–90% of days

Day-to-day highs hold fairly steady near 31°C through the month.

A typical December day in Osvaldo Cruz reaches about 31°C in the afternoon and slips back to 22°C overnight — a 9°C spread between the day's warmth and the night's chill. On most days the high lands between 28°C and 34°C. Set against its neighbours, December runs on par with November and on par with January.

Chance of precipitation in December

Any precipitation

Osvaldo Cruz gets around 172 mm of rain over 18.8 wet days in December. The line is the day-by-day chance of measurable precipitation.

Day to day, the chance of measurable rain averages around 61% and peaks near 67% on the wettest days. The odds climb toward the end of the month.

Sunrise & sunset in December

DaylightNight

Daylight runs from about 13 h 12 min at the start of December to 13 h 18 min by month's end. The lit band spans sunrise to sunset each day.

Days grow by about 6 minutes over December. Sunrise moves from 6:36 AM to 6:47 AM, and sunset from 7:50 PM to 8:06 PM.

UV index in Osvaldo Cruz in December

LowModerateHighVery highExtreme

Clear-sky midday UV in December peaks around 13 (very high — sun protection essential). The full-year curve, shaded by WHO exposure level, is below.

Under clear skies, the midday UV index in Osvaldo Cruz peaks around January 21 at about 15 (extreme) — sunscreen, a hat and midday shade are essential. It bottoms out near July 11 at about 6 (high).

The index reaches 3 or more — the level where the WHO recommends sun protection — every month of the year.

Location & terrain

Where is Osvaldo Cruz?

Osvaldo Cruz sits at 21.8°S, 50.9°W, 465 m above sea level, in Brazil. The nearest listed city is Lucélia, 17 km away.

Topography around Osvaldo Cruz

How much the land rises and falls, and what covers it, within 3, 16 and 80 km of Osvaldo Cruz.

Within 3 km, the terrain around Osvaldo Cruz has only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 101 m around an average of 447 m above sea level; within 16 km, only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 188 m; within 80 km, significant vari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 358 m.

The land around Osvaldo Cruz is covered by grassland (42%), trees (23%) and artificial surfaces (23%) within 3 km, grassland (44%) and cropland (38%) within 16 km, and cropland (52%) and grassland (36%) within 80 km.
